Excursion to Rail Museum
The students of Nursery to Class V of Hope Hall Foundation School visited The National Rail Museum on 30 January as part of an educational picnic organised by the school.
The young learners were delighted to see the historic locomotives, railway coaches, and exhibits displayed at the museum. The visit helped them learn simple and interesting facts about the railways in an engaging and enjoyable manner. Teachers accompanied the students throughout the trip, ensuring their safety, care, and discipline.
The picnic was well organised and proved to be both educational and enjoyable. The students returned to school safely with happy memories, making the visit a memorable experience for all.
